Players who have played for Real Madrid and Atletico Madrid

Atletico Madrid and Real Madrid are local rivals, but it is certainly not one of the most heated rivalries in world football. The two Spanish giants have heat between them, but it’s not as big as the one Los Blancos have with Barcelona nor is it like Arsenal v Tottenham.

But still, playing for one club almost automatically makes it very difficult for a player to move to the other side of Madrid. So much so that in the 116-year rivalry of these clubs, only a few players have played both sides!

Marcos Llorente’s transfer from Real Madrid to Atletico makes him the 30th player ever to be a part of both the Madrid sides. He’s joining Los Rojiblancos in a €40 million deal.

Without further ado, here are the top 9 players who have represented both the Madrid sides so far:

#9 – Hugo Sanchez

Hugo Sanchez is arguably one of the best footballers the world has ever seen. The Mexican joined Atletico Madrid in 1981 and stayed at the club for 5 years. The striker scored 54 times in over 100 appearances and earned a transfer to Real Madrid.

The move brought the best out of Sanchez and he went on to score 35+ in 4 consecutive seasons. After scoring 164 goals in 207 apps over 7 seasons at Bernabeu, the striker decided to move back to Mexico.

He played for a variety of clubs in Spain, USA and Austria before retiring in 1997.

#8 – Bernd Schuster

Bernd Schuster is the only footballer ever to play for Atletico Madrid, Real Madrid and Barcelona. The German midfielder spent 8 seasons at Camp Nou (1980-88) before joining Real Madrid, a team he later managed for one and half season (2007-08).

He spent just 2 seasons at Bernabeu before heading to their local rivals, Atletico Madrid where he spent 3 seasons. Schuster played for Bayer Leverkusen and UNAM Pumas before hanging his boots in 1997.

#7 – Raul

Real Madrid, Raul is not actually an Atletico Madrid youth product but he spent 2 seasons with them before moving to Los Blancos. The Spaniard was signed by them from CD San Cristóbal de los Ángeles and helped Atleti win the national title with the Cadete team.

Atletico’s decision to close their academy a year later saw Raul move to Real Madrid and rest, as they say, is history. He went on to play for Los Blancos for 16 years (plus 2 years in the youth system) and became a club legend. He moved to Schakle 04, Al Sadd and New York Cosmos between 2010 and 2015 before calling it quits.

#6 – Santiago Solari

Former Real Madrid, Santiago Solari have not lasted long as a manager at Bernabeu but as a player, he spent 5 seasons there. The midfielder was signed by Vicente del Bosque in 2000 and after making 131 apps over 5 years, he moved to Inter Milan.

Solari was a part of the Atletico Madrid side that got relegated in the 1999/00 season. He had just joined from River Plate at the start of the season and despite the club’s relegation, he was seen as the shining star by Del Bosque.

#5 – Jose Antonio Reyes 

Jose Antonio Reyes’ is well known for his time at Arsenal and Atletico Madrid. However, in between the spells at the aforementioned clubs, he spent a season on loan at Real Madrid.

Reyes scored 6 goals in 30 appearances for Los Blancos after moving to Bernabeu in a loan-swap deal involving Júlio Baptista. He scored twice on the final day of the season to help Madrid win the title in dramatic fashion.

He joined Atletico in the summer and spent 4 years at the club before moving to Sevilla. Reyes tragically passed away on June 1st, 2019 in a car accident while travelling between Utrera and Seville with his cousins.

#4 – Thibaut Courtois

Thibaut Courtois spent 3 years at Atletico Madrid on loan from Chelsea. The Belgian was sent to the Spanish to develop by the Premier League side as they had Petr Cech as their #1 at that time.

Courtois forced his way to Real Madrid in the summer of 2018 after going AWOL. The goalkeeper joined for €35M + Kovacic (on loan) but could not replicate the form at Atletico in his first season at Bernabeu.

#3 – Juanfran

After 8 seasons at Atletico Madrid, Juanfran has left the club this summer. The defender was signed from Osasuna for just €4 million in 2011 and has become a club legend.

However, before joining Osasuna, Juanfran was on the books of Real Madrid. The Spaniard was signed by Los Blancos from Kelme when he was a youth and he made 6 appearances for the senior team before he was sold.

#2 – Theo Hernandez

Theo Hernandez joining Real Madrid came as a shock for Atletico Madrid. The Rojiblancos could not block the transfer as Real had activated his release clause and the defender was keen on moving.

He was yet to make an appearance for the senior side at Atletico and the lure of Real got him to switch sides in 2017. He spent a season at Bernabeu before getting loned to Real Sociedad. His future at the club is in the balance as Madrid have signed Ferland Mendy despite already having Marcelo and Sergio Reguilón in the squad as left-backs.

#1 – Alvaro Morata

Alvaro Morata started his career at Atletico Madrid’s academy before heading to Getafe and then Real Madrid. The striker made a few senior appearances for Los Blancos but his best spell came at Juventus.

Blancos signed him back after 2 seasons before selling him to Chelsea a year later. Despite a decent start, Morata often misfired for the Premier League side and is now on an 18-month loan at Atletico Madrid, who have the option of signing him permanently next summer.

The other 20 to play for both clubs: Triana, Cabo, Luis Olaso, Vázquez, Eduardo Ordóñez, Jaime Lazcano, Luis Marín, Pruden, Luis Aragonés, Ramón Grosso, Juanito, Paco Llorente, Sebastián Losada, Miquel Soler, Juan Esnáider, Pedro Jaro, José García Calvo, Rodrigo Fabri, José Manuel Jurado, Antonio Adán.
